Black Box Theater
This theatre is also known as experimental theatre. Recent, consisting of a simple, somewhat unadorned performance space, usually a large square room with black walls and a flat floor. SHEULEE: Night Jasmine
Coral jasmine commonly known as night jasmine is known in Bangladesh as shiuli ful.People calls it as shefali ful also. Night jasmine or shiuli ful is a highly perfumed flower.The tree is sometimes called the ”tree of sorrow”,because the flowers lose their brightness during daytime. Dayarampur Rajbari
Dayarampur, now the Kadirabad Cantonment is 12 km west of Banpara in Natore district and is situated on the bank of the river Baral. It is a branch of Dighapatia zamindari.
